Members of the division also provide inpatient and emergency consultations at the QEII Health Sciences Centre, IWK Health Centre and the Dartmouth General Hospital. Our division was instrumental in developing a province-wide Colon Cancer Prevention Program that provides all Nova Scotians between the ages of 50 and 74 with access to a home screening kit.
